116 changes: 116 additions & 0 deletions arch/arm/mach-davinci/usb.c
Original file line number Diff line number Diff line change
@@ -0,0 +1,116 @@
/*
* USB
*/
#include <linux/kernel.h>
#include <linux/module.h>
#include <linux/init.h>
#include <linux/platform_device.h>
#include <linux/dma-mapping.h>

#include <linux/usb/musb.h>
#include <linux/usb/otg.h>

#include <mach/common.h>
#include <mach/hardware.h>

#if defined(CONFIG_USB_MUSB_HDRC) || defined(CONFIG_USB_MUSB_HDRC_MODULE)
static struct musb_hdrc_eps_bits musb_eps[] = {
{ "ep1_tx", 8, },
{ "ep1_rx", 8, },
{ "ep2_tx", 8, },
{ "ep2_rx", 8, },
{ "ep3_tx", 5, },
{ "ep3_rx", 5, },
{ "ep4_tx", 5, },
{ "ep4_rx", 5, },
};

static struct musb_hdrc_config musb_config = {
.multipoint = true,
.dyn_fifo = true,
.soft_con = true,
.dma = true,

.num_eps = 5,
.dma_channels = 8,
.ram_bits = 10,
.eps_bits = musb_eps,
};

static struct musb_hdrc_platform_data usb_data = {
#if defined(CONFIG_USB_MUSB_OTG)
/* OTG requires a Mini-AB connector */
.mode = MUSB_OTG,
#elif defined(CONFIG_USB_MUSB_PERIPHERAL)
.mode = MUSB_PERIPHERAL,
#elif defined(CONFIG_USB_MUSB_HOST)
.mode = MUSB_HOST,
#endif
.config = &musb_config,
};

static struct resource usb_resources[] = {
{
/* physical address */
.start = DAVINCI_USB_OTG_BASE,
.end = DAVINCI_USB_OTG_BASE + 0x5ff,
.flags = IORESOURCE_MEM,
},
{
.start = IRQ_USBINT,
.flags = IORESOURCE_IRQ,
},
};

static u64 usb_dmamask = DMA_32BIT_MASK;

static struct platform_device usb_dev = {
.name = "musb_hdrc",
.id = -1,
.dev = {
.platform_data = &usb_data,
.dma_mask = &usb_dmamask,
.coherent_dma_mask = DMA_32BIT_MASK,
},
.resource = usb_resources,
.num_resources = ARRAY_SIZE(usb_resources),
};

#ifdef CONFIG_USB_MUSB_OTG

static struct otg_transceiver *xceiv;

struct otg_transceiver *otg_get_transceiver(void)
{
if (xceiv)
get_device(xceiv->dev);
return xceiv;
}
EXPORT_SYMBOL(otg_get_transceiver);

int otg_set_transceiver(struct otg_transceiver *x)
{
if (xceiv && x)
return -EBUSY;
xceiv = x;
return 0;
}
EXPORT_SYMBOL(otg_set_transceiver);

#endif

void __init setup_usb(unsigned mA, unsigned potpgt_msec)
{
usb_data.power = mA / 2;
usb_data.potpgt = potpgt_msec / 2;
platform_device_register(&usb_dev);
}

#else

void __init setup_usb(unsigned mA, unsigned potpgt_msec)
{
}

#endif /* CONFIG_USB_MUSB_HDRC */
